Transaction 8014f35531e84bc552738fa2f0a8b87278f1c93cc805d0a46378c7795e78c9fb
1 Input
1 Output
-
8014f35531e84bc552738fa2f0a8b87278f1c93cc805d0a46378c7795e78c9fb:0
- value
- 16475212
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 41f58dd64666fd9a5503dd2e6087c0c1d2052130 OP_EQUAL
- address
- 37hn1QaNcFg7ruiCtArGjtfLkwh2JRSf8d